Add persistent browser auth to connector canvas

Replace Azure CLI-only authentication with InteractiveBrowserCredential, protected sign-in lifecycle endpoints, and subscription refresh after sign-in. Persist the Azure Identity cache securely across extension reloads and align connector restart guidance with the GitHub Copilot app.
